    The Rise of AI in Entertainment

    The entertainment industry is experiencing a seismic shift, primarily driven by advancements in artificial intelligence (AI). The rise of AI in entertainment is reshaping how content is created, curated, and consumed, offering new pathways for creativity and engagement. AI technologies are increasingly being deployed in various aspects of entertainment, transforming traditional processes into automated, efficient systems.

    One of the most notable applications of AI is in content creation. Automated writing processes powered by natural language processing tools are capable of generating scripts or news articles at a pace and scale previously unimaginable. For instance, AI writing assistants can produce engaging narratives, saving time for creators while providing them with innovative ideas that can be further developed. Additionally, AI-generated art and music are pushing the boundaries of creativity, providing artists with novel tools and inspiration. By leveraging algorithms, these technologies can analyze vast amounts of data to generate unique compositions that resonate with audiences.

    Personalization is another critical aspect where AI is leaving its mark. Streaming platforms and social media networks utilize AI-driven recommendations to enhance consumer experience, tailoring content to individual preferences. These algorithms analyze user behavior and viewing habits to curate personalized playlists, ensuring that viewers engage with content that aligns with their tastes. This personalization not only improves user satisfaction but also keeps consumers engaged, a crucial factor in today’s competitive entertainment landscape.

    However, the integration of AI into creative fields raises ethical considerations that must be addressed. Concerns regarding authorship, intellectual property rights, and the potential impact on jobs within creative industries are at the forefront of discussions among industry stakeholders. As entertainment trends evolve with AI at the helm, stakeholders must navigate these complexities to ensure that ethical standards are maintained while embracing innovation.

    Immersive Technologies: The Future of Storytelling

    With the rapid advancement of technology, immersive storytelling has emerged as a dominant force in the entertainment industry. Immersive technologies, primarily encompassing virtual reality (VR) and augmented reality (AR), have significantly altered the landscape of content creation and consumption. These technologies allow for an engaging blend of storytelling and interactive experiences, setting the stage for the future of entertainment trends.

    Virtual reality has gained traction, providing users with fully immersive experiences that transport them into the narrative. For example, VR gaming has become exceptionally popular, with platforms like Oculus Quest offering games that enable players to step into fantastical worlds, interact with characters, and shape the storyline. In film, VR short films and experiences have encouraged innovation by allowing viewers to explore stories from multiple perspectives, something traditional cinema cannot offer.

    On the other hand, augmented reality layers digital content onto the real world, creating a unique storytelling medium. Applications such as Pokémon GO have shown the potential of AR by blending real-life exploration with digital gameplay. Similarly, AR in live events has revolutionized how audiences engage with performances, allowing them to view additional content or interact with elements of the show via their devices. This hybridization of reality and digital experience is reshaping audience expectations and how stories are communicated.

    As these immersive technologies continue to evolve, their capacity to create compelling narratives and enhance user engagement will likely redefine entertainment trends. The integration of AI-driven elements within AR and VR applications can further personalize experiences, tailoring narratives to the individual preferences of the viewer. As we look to the future, the potential for VR and AR in storytelling holds immense promise, offering new avenues for creativity and engagement that traditional media formats cannot match.

    The Boom of Short-Form Vertical Content

    In recent years, there has been a notable shift towards short-form vertical content, particularly in mobile-oriented formats. This transformation is fueled significantly by the popularity of platforms such as TikTok, Instagram Reels, and YouTube Shorts. These platforms have not only led the charge in delivering bite-sized entertainment but have also carved out a new cultural landscape that emphasizes efficiency and rapid consumption of information. The trend towards short-form content caters to the contemporary viewer’s shorter attention span, facilitating quick and engaging experiences.

    The format of vertical videos is particularly significant, as it aligns effortlessly with the way individuals consume content on their mobile devices. This shift towards verticality in production has changed content creation strategies dramatically. Creators are now focusing on producing engaging content that captures interest within mere seconds, transforming how narratives are constructed and delivered. The majority of videos on these platforms are intentionally designed to be concise yet impactful, which plays a crucial role in audience engagement and retention.

    This change is not merely aesthetic; it reflects a broader cultural trend where consumers are navigating a fast-paced digital landscape. The rise of short-form vertical content signifies a departure from long, traditional media formats that can often feel cumbersome and time-consuming. A focus on brevity in entertainment trends is reshaping expectations, encouraging brands and content creators to innovate continuously to capture audience interest effectively.

    Indeed, the surge of short-form content reveals a compelling need for quick gratification in media consumption. It has prompted marketers and content strategists to rethink how they communicate and interact with their audiences, ensuring that their messages are not only succinct but also resonant. This ongoing evolution in content consumption and creation underscores the enduring impact of mobile technology and the shift in entertainment trends.

    Looking Ahead: The Future of Entertainment in a Tech-Driven World

    As we look toward the future, the entertainment landscape appears poised for significant transformation, driven by the rapid convergence of artificial intelligence, immersive technologies, and evolving consumption patterns. The rise of AI, in particular, plays a crucial role in redefining how content is created, distributed, and consumed. With sophisticated algorithms increasingly capable of personalizing experiences based on user preferences, we can expect entertainment trends to become even more tailored to individual tastes.

    Moreover, the integration of immersive technologies, such as virtual reality (VR) and augmented reality (AR), is likely to elevate consumer engagement levels, inviting audiences into deeply interactive narratives. From virtual concert experiences to immersive storytelling formats, these technologies promise to redefine audience engagement and participation in entertainment. As creators and studios begin adopting these tools, the nature of storytelling is expected to evolve, moving towards more dynamic and participatory forms.

    However, this evolution is not without its challenges. As content creators navigate these new landscapes, they will face pressures to keep up with technological advancements while maintaining high-quality storytelling. Intellectual property rights and ethical considerations regarding AI-generated content will likely spark intense debate among industry stakeholders. Furthermore, the proliferation of short-form content, particularly in social media environments, may require traditional studios to rethink their strategies and embrace flexibility in content production.

    In addition, consumer behavior is expected to shift as viewers increasingly crave immediate, snackable content that mobile devices facilitate. As competition for attention escalates, entertainment platforms may need to innovate continuously to stay relevant. Collectively, these factors will profoundly shape industry standards and practices over the next decade, highlighting the need for adaptability in a rapidly evolving entertainment landscape.
